Christian Vazquez signed a minor league contract with the Houston Astros that includes an invitation to Spring Training.
This marks Vazquez's second stint with Houston, after being acquired as a trade deadline pickup during the 2022 season. Vazquez hit .250/.278/.308 over 108 plate appearances with the Astros during the rest of the 2022 regular season and .235/.316/.235 over 19 postseason plate appearances. He was behind the plate for the Astros' combined no-hitter in Game 4 of the World Series that year.
The veteran catcher spent three seasons with the Minnesota Twins after signing a three-year, $30 million free agent deal in the 2022 offseason. He hit .215/.267/.311 over 884 plate appearances during his tenure with Minnesota. In the 2025 season, Vazquez logged +5 Defensive Runs Saved over 519 innings at catcher and threw out 14 of 56 base-stealing attempts.
Vazquez will compete with Cesar Salazar for the backup catching job behind starter Yainer Diaz.
